Police Partners in the
community “AWAY DAY”
Ann Lofthouse and Cathy
Parr are EAZ Attendance
Officers and have been
involved in a fantastic
attendance project with Karen
Jaundrill Scott, EAZ Arts
Consultant and artists from
the Artzone.
Ann and Cathy work in EAZ
schools to promote good
attendance and punctuality
through liaison with schools,
parents and children,
assemblies and competitions.
When St. Helens Police
wanted to fund a series of
playlets in a selection of
EAZ schools aimed at
highlighting truancy issues
they were very enthusiastic
about the project and excited
about being involved.
The dramas were based on
three school age characters,
Danny, Joanne and Lisa who
miss school for different
reasons.
The children were encouraged
to question each character to
find out more about their
problems, and then split into
groups to discuss them and
find ways to enable them to
attend school.
Along with the actors, Ann,
Cathy and Community Police
Officers took each group and
came up with solutions to
their problems.
Each group then gave
feedback on their outcomes.
Two children were asked to
give their views on the
plays.

James, from St Austin’s
reported, “It was fantastic!
I found it very interesting
because the three
characters had different
problems, some we hadn’t
heard about before.
We were made to think
about things more and we
learned where we would go
to find help.”
Joanna from Allanson
Street Primary decided that
“Adults care about us! The
play demonstrates that they
want us to be in school
and SAFE! The message
at the end of the day was
simple “don’t be off school
unless you are actually ill
– DON’T TRUANT!”
The plays were very
successful and will be
repeated.
